I'm sorry but that is an ignorant statement. Costs is not your own legal fees but the feel of those who you summoned to court. Under English law if I were to sue you and lose, I would have to pay for your legal fees. Under American law, you lose or win, you and I pay for our own legal costs. However in certain exemptions, the judge can rule the losing party to pay legal costs of the winning party.
